The Bachelor of Engineering (Honours) and Diploma of Professional Practice (Co-Op Engineering) is a Bachelor Honours Degree course from Central Queensland University. The CRICOS code for this course is 083587C. The main language of Bachelor of Engineering (Honours) and Diploma of Professional Practice (Co-Op Engineering) is English.

In Australia, training providers must be approved for registration on the Commonwealth Register of Institutions and Courses for Overseas Students (CRICOS) before they can teach overseas students. The Bachelor of Engineering (Honours) and Diploma of Professional Practice (Co-Op Engineering) is an approved CRICOS course from Central Queensland University.

The field of studies for Bachelor of Engineering (Honours) and Diploma of Professional Practice (Co-Op Engineering) is Engineering and Related Technologies, Other Engineering and Related Technologies and Engineering and Related Technologies, n.e.c..

Course Duration

The Course duration on CRICOS must accurately reflect the time taken by a student to complete the course including any reasonable compulsory periods of orientation.

Course duration234 weeks / 4.5 years

The total course duration for Bachelor of Engineering (Honours) and Diploma of Professional Practice (Co-Op Engineering) is around 234 weeks. The registered duration cannot exceed the time required for completing the course on the basis of the normal amount of full-time study, and must not include any period of work-based training unless this is necessary in order to obtain the course qualification. Course duration should not include the period between when assessments or examinations for the course have been completed, and the time when results become available.

This course includes work component of 36.3 hours per week and total 48 weeks which is total of 1740 hours of Work. Work component hours (WIL hours) that are formally registered as part of the course are not included in the fortnight limitation.
